Thwarting protein synthesis leads to malaria parasite paralysis
2022
Mayoka, Godfrey | Woodland, John G. | Chibale, Kelly
Inhibiting translation presents a tantalizing strategy to tackle the most virulent human malaria parasite. Xie et al. disclose a compound that binds selectively to Plasmodium falciparum tyrosine aminoacyl-tRNA synthetase, preventing the incorporation of tyrosine into nascent proteins and paving the way for a new generation of safe, effective antimalarials.
